It seems like there’s no stopping the steamroller that is DC’s rebooted ‘Justice League’ title. Just last month, we announced that the #1 issue of the new series was headed back to press for a fifth printing. Now, the DC Universe: The Source blog has announced that a sixth printing is on its way!

The rebooted ‘Justice League’ title is the lead-in series for a lot of other titles of DC’s New 52 Universe. The first story arc is set some five years before most of the other titles in the new DC lineup to provide backstory to the characters and an origin for the superhero team. ‘Justice League’ is written by Geoff Johns (‘Green Lantern: Rebirth’) with art from Jim Lee (‘All-Star Batman and Robin’).

For those looking to catch up, the sixth printing of ‘Justice League’ #1 is scheduled to hit comic book shelves on February 15, 2012.
